説明

This comprehensive exploration delves into the complexities of the American Congress, shedding light on its structure, processes, and significance in the governance of the United States. With an analytical lens, the authors dissect how the legislative branch operates, including the intricate dynamics between the House of Representatives and the Senate, as well as the impact of political parties and interest groups.

Through detailed examinations, readers gain an understanding of the legislative process, from bill introduction to final approval. The authors illustrate how various factors, such as public opinion and partisan alignment, influence decision-making and policy outcomes. This analysis is particularly pertinent as it reflects the evolving nature of American politics.

The book also addresses the historical context of Congress, offering insights into its transformation over time and the ongoing challenges it faces. It paints a vivid picture of the political landscape, emphasizing the role of Congress in shaping both domestic and foreign policy.

Richly informed with examples and case studies, the narrative balances theoretical concepts with practical implications. This engaging work serves as an essential resource for scholars, students, and anyone interested in understanding the fundamental workings of one of the most crucial elements of American democracy.
